成吉思汗策划文档-装备合成,拆解和改造的算法描述.docVIP

成吉思汗策划文档-装备合成,拆解和改造的算法描述.doc

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
成吉思汗 装备后期玩法需求 日期 修改内容 具体内容 修订人 2008-2-18 创建文档 描述装备合成,拆解,改造的过程和数值算法 孙魁武 2008-3-10 增加 HYPERLINK 描述合成改造时的属性生成方法。 孙魁武 表格设计 下表为装备合成,拆解,改造的通用表格。为了方便查看,这里将表格进行了转置。 下面对表格中的每一项进行描述。 INT 配方号 1 INT 产品IDSTRING 配方名称 鬼头刀配方 BYTE 产品数量 1 SHORT 材料类1 20001 BYTE 材料数量1 5 BYTE 材料最低等级1 2 BYTE 拆解损耗比例1 50 SHORT 材料类2 20002 BYTE 材料数量2 5 BYTE 材料最低等级2 2 BYTE 拆解损耗比例2 50 SHORT 材料类3 -1 BYTE 材料数量3 -1 BYTE 材料最低等级3 -1 BYTE 拆解损耗比例3 -1 SHORT 材料类4 -1 BYTE 材料数量4 -1 BYTE 材料最低等级4 -1 BYTE 拆解损耗比例4 -1 INT 改造1材料类 20001 INT 改造1材料数量 2 INT 改造1材料最低等级 2 INT 改造2材料类 20002 INT 改造2材料数量 2 INT 改造2材料最低等级 2 INT 改造3材料类 20001 INT 改造3材料数量 5 INT 改造3材料最低等级 2 INT 操作时间 3000 INT 脚本ID -1 配方号 配方的唯一编号,顺序排列。 产品ID 合成时的产物ID。 配方名称 该配方的显示名称。 产品数量 合成时,产物的数量。 材料类1 规定了合成时消耗的材料种类;拆解时可能产出的材料种类。这里填写的数字为物品类型(2位)+材料种类(3位)。 材料数量1 规定了合成时消耗的材料数目;拆解时产生材料的基数; 材料最低等级1 规定了合成时,需求材料的最低等级。例如:材料最低等级为2,则该类材料,等级大于等于2的都可以用于此配方的合成。 拆解损耗比例1 规定了拆解时,材料损耗的比例。拆解时,最终得到的材料数量=材料数量*(100-拆解损耗比例)/100。 改造1材料类 对此道具进行改造1(如属性改造)时消耗的材料种类。这里填写的数字为物品类型(2位)+材料种类(3位)。 改造1材料数量 对此道具进行改造1(如属性改造)时消耗的材料数量。 改造1材料最低等级 对此道具进行改造1(如属性改造)时,需求材料的最低等级。 操作时间 对此道具进行操作所需要的时间。 脚本ID 如果出现极其复杂的情况,调用脚本处理该配方。调用脚本时,除了配方号,所有的参数作废,仅使用脚本中的参数。如果无脚本,此列填-1。 合成时的算法描述 首先存在一个描述所有属性标准的表格,可参考属性数值表。在该表中描述各等级装备的标准数值。而合成或者改造的过程可以看作对此标准数值的强化。而强化的权重来自于材料。因此得到如下公式: 属性的最终数值=标准*权重 在材料升级必然成功的条件下: 如果N级材料的权重为n,升级到N+1需要m个材料,那么N+1级材料的权重为n*m+1。这里加1的目的是保证高一级的材料效果总是比第一级的好。 按照4合1的比例,得到材料分表数值如下: 1级 1 2级 5 3级 21 4级 85 5级 341 6级 1365 7级 5461 8级 21845 9级 87381 10级 349525 11级 1398101 12级 5592405 13级14级15级 357913941 将其转化为线性: T=Ln(X) 这里T就是要应用于数值计算的权重。 如果线形公式不能满足需求,可以进行下一步的改造,如转化成2次等。在转化过程中需要保证一点:在这些数值范围内,函数为单增。 假设合成时需要材料个数为S,则最终的数值等级分布为上表中的数值*S*C。 C是一个系数,用来控制取值范围。假设S=4. 按公式T=Ln(SX)计算后的数值如下: 1级 1.3862944 2级 2.9957323 3级 4.4308168 4级 5.8289456 5级 7.2181768 6级 8.6052041 7级 9.9916816 8级 11.378022 9级 12.764328 10级 14.150625 11级 15.53692 12级 16.923214 13级 18.309509 14级 19.695803 15级 21.082097 上表为4个同等材料合 成同级物品的权重表。如果4个材料等级不同,则合成出来的道具权重为T= Ln(X1+X2+X3+X4)。 在合成时需要记录

文档评论(0)

专注于金融公司,实体制造业,销售代理公司的企业文化和实体项目或者互联网项目的策划编写润色,曾经协助多家基金公司,保险代理公司,房地产代销公司等初创企业完成企业文化和人事营销等制度的编写,由于疫情影响离开了喜欢的首都。

1亿VIP精品文档

相关文档